Abstract
⺠A multi-photon above-dissociation spectrum of water is analyzed using first principles quantum mechanics for both the electronic structure and nuclear motion problems. ⺠The observed resonance structure is analyzed and assignments made. ⺠Both shape and Feshbach resonances are identified. ⺠A broad peak at dissociation is ascribed to direct photodissociation into the continuum.
